This has a great screen! And is easy to figure out (without reading the instructions) with just a few minutes of play. I have yet to get lost. The sound is good and loud and clear. The picture is clear and even tells you your speed accurately. The screen is actually a bit large for my car so I have to keep it next to me instead of on the dash.

My only problem is that the cord is really short. The coils are so tight that it pulls the whole thing.
